Hybrid nanofluid flow past a shrinking cylinder with prescribed surface heat flux
This numerical study was devoted to examining the occurrence of non-unique solutions in boundary layer flow due to deformable surfaces (cylinder and flat plate) with the imposition of prescribed surface heat flux.
